when i open a new window (f.e. a login-screen or sth) i always get an additional new blank tab in front of. its really annoying, because after logging in the blank tab in the new window stays open. what can i do to quit this behaviour? its only on this pc. never had this before...

You can check the home page setting:

  • Tools > Options > General > Startup: Home page

Firefox supports multiple home pages separated by '|' (pipe) symbols.

more options

i read this somewhere before, but it doesn't solve the problem.

more options

Επιλεγμένη λύση

What is the home page setting if you check the value of the browser.startup.homepage pref on the about:config page?

Start Firefox in Safe Mode to check if one of the extensions (Firefox/Tools > Add-ons > Extensions) or if hardware acceleration is causing the problem (switch to the DEFAULT theme: Firefox/Tools > Add-ons > Appearance).

  • Do NOT click the Reset button on the Safe Mode start window.
more options

yeah, it was the addon webPG. alright, safe mode is really helpful. never used this before. thanks a lot! c
